What is stopping distance?
The minimum distance required to stop a vehicle in an
emergency

What is the formula for total stopping distance?
Total stopping distance =
thinking distance
+
braking distance

What are the components of stopping distance?
Thinking distance: distance traveled during driver's
reaction time
Braking distance
: distance taken to stop after brakes are applied

What affects thinking distance?
The
speed
of the vehicle and the driver's
reaction time

How does speed affect thinking distance?
Higher speed increases
thinking
distance

What factors can increase a driver's reaction time?
Being
tired
,
drunk
, on
drugs
, or
distracted

What is braking distance?
The distance taken to stop under
braking force

What factors affect braking distance?
The
speed
and
mass
of the vehicle, and the
condition
of the brakes

How does the condition of brakes affect braking distance?
Worn
or faulty brakes reduce stopping power, increasing braking distance

How does road condition affect stopping distance?
Wet
or
icy
roads reduce
friction
, increasing stopping distance

What happens if tires are bald?
Bald tires cannot grip the road well, increasing
stopping distance

How does speed impact stopping distance?
Thinking distance increases
proportionally
with speed
Braking distance increases more quickly than expected:
Doubling speed increases braking distance
four-fold
Tripling speed increases braking distance
nine-fold

What does the graph of total stopping distance against speed look like?
It is not a
straight line
; it gets steeper as speed increases
